South Easton Man Recovers Top Secret Blueprints Stolen from 5 Wits Patriot Place

Discovery earns Chad Sylvester a handsome reward from Patriot Place's interactive entertainment venue.

FOXBOROUGH, Mass. – With the fate of the world hanging in the balance, South Easton resident Chad Sylvester answered the call and set out on a mission to recover top secret blueprints stolen from the Espionage Adventure at 5 Wits Patriot Place earlier this month.

Sylvester discovered the blueprints rolled inside two foot-long white tubes and stashed atop shelving at Bass Pro Shops at Patriot Place. The blueprints contained sensitive information for the Gridlock Satellite, which has the capability to disrupt all communication on Earth if the data falls into the wrong hands.

As a result of his brilliant work as a spy, 5 Wits Patriot Place rewarded Sylvester with a Spy Kit containing spy glasses, fedora, messenger bag, walkie talkies, door alarm, night scope, dart trap, motion alarm, tactical mirror, invisible writer journal and pen, fake moustaches, fingerprint kit, senior operations and 5 Wits Espionage shirts. Sylvester also received four VIP admission passes to 5 Wits.

5 Wits is a family-friendly venue for adults, college students and children ages seven and older. Adventures fully immerse you in a vibrant, physical world that’s unlike anything you’ve ever experienced. With cutting-edge, live-action entertainment, participants are called upon to solve puzzles, explore new spaces and discover the details of your unique story.

At Patriot Place, guests can experience the adventures, Espionage and 20,000 Leagues. In Espionage, you’ll be trained as spies, infiltrating and taking down an evil corporation determined to stop you at every turn. In 20,000 Leagues, you’ll get caught up in the riddle of Captain Nemo’s lost ship when your tour group accidentally discovers the Nautilus.

5 Wits Productions, located in Norwood, Mass., was founded by owner/designer Matthew DuPlessie in 2004, and currently has entertainment venues in Foxborough, Mass., Boston, Washington D.C., Pigeon Forge, Tenn. and Syracuse, N.Y.

The name, “5 Wits,” comes from Shakespearean times. The five wits were said to be Imagination, Estimation, Fantasy, Common Sense and Memory – all aspects that make an appearance in the franchise’s numerous adventures. The name can also be associated with the five senses, which is appropriate, because you use all of them during a 5 Wits adventure.
